GOP resists calls for special prosecutor after Comey firing
Senate Republicans are resisting renewed calls from Democrats for the appointment of a special prosecutor to look into Russia's actions in last year's election after President Trumps firing of FBI Director James Comey.
Republicans, already facing a difficult legislative agenda, fear the controversy could become even more of a media circus and distract from efforts to pass healthcare legislation and tax reform through the Senate.
Democrats ramped up pressure Wednesday by blocking committee hearings and objecting to routine procedural requests in protest of Comeys dismissal.
Senate Democratic Leader Charles Schumer (N.Y.) declared that Trumps Justice Department could not be trusted to conduct an investigation into Russias meddling in the 2016 election, which would include looking at possible links to the presidents campaign.
